Release checklist — Validata plugin system, v0.9. Confirm plugin manifest schema is frozen; no new fields after code freeze. Verify third-party validators load in the restricted interpreter only. Run the conformance suite against all six bundled plugins; zero skips allowed. Sign-off from platform and QA required before tagging. Record sign-offs against the release build noted below.

trace token, fafog-kageg: htk4_98e6

**Minutes — Management Meeting, Arravale Goods**

For the board. Attendees: ops, product, and commercial leads.

We walked through the launch plan for the Marigold kitchen line. Packaging is signed off, the pilot run at the Hollis Cross plant went cleanly, and retail partners in the Westbray corridor are briefed. Launch date holds at early next quarter, pending final freight confirmation. Budget tracks on plan. The confidential planning note for the board follows directly below.

board note of yagag-yagaf: Holixox Freight is in early talks to buy Holielox Freight for about $471.5 million. The Zorys launch date is May 11, and nothing goes to the press before then. Legal wants the Julethek Works term sheet withdrawn before August 19.

## Deploying the Gatewick Proctor Queue

Deploys are pretty painless: push to main, wait for the pipeline, then watch the queue drain dashboard for five minutes. If candidates pile up mid-exam, roll back first and ask questions later — the queue replays safely. Everything the workers care about lives in one config block, shown here for reference.

settings of bafof-yagef:
JOROX_PIN=8740
JOROX_TENANT=pelox
JOROX_METRICS_HOST=metrics.jorox.qorvelworks.internal
JOROX_SEAL=seal_c78f63c1
JOROX_STANDBY_TEAM=norax

## 3.2.0 — Changed defaults

Per-tenant rate quotas in Meterling now default to the burst-aware model rather than fixed windows. Existing tenants keep their explicit overrides; only tenants on implicit defaults are affected. Support should expect questions about 429 timing shifting slightly earlier under sustained load. For reference, the new default quota values are as follows.

deployment values, yahag-tawef:
ZORWYN_HOST=zorwyn.tolvaqlabs.internal
ZORWYN_PORT=9300